What is Cosmetology

Grand Island NY hair stylist cutting hairCosmetology is a profession that is everything about making the human anatomy look more beautiful through the application of cosmetics. So naturally it makes sense that a number of cosmetology schools are described as beauty schools. Many of us think of makeup when we hear the term cosmetics, but really a cosmetic can be anything that enhances the look of a person’s skin, hair or nails. If you want to work as a cosmetologist, the majority of states mandate that you undergo some kind of specialized training and then be licensed. Once you are licensed, the work settings include not only Grand Island NY beauty salons and barber shops, but also such places as spas, hotels and resorts. Many cosmetologists, after they have acquired experience and a clientele, launch their own shops or salons. Others will begin seeing clients either in their own homes or will travel to the client’s house, or both. Cosmetology college graduates have many names and work in a wide variety of specialties including:

  • Hairdressers
  • Hairstylists
  • Beauticians
  • Barbers
  • Manicurists
  • Nail Technicians
  • Makeup Artists
  • Hair Coloring Specialists
  • Estheticians
  • Electrolysis Technicians

As already stated, in most states practicing cosmetologists have to be licensed. In certain states there is an exemption. Only those conducting more skilled services, such as hairstylists, are required to be licensed. Others working in cosmetology and less skilled, such as shampooers, are not required to be licensed in those states.

Cosmetologist Degrees and Certificates

nail techs training at Grand Island NY beauty schoolThere are primarily two options offered to receive cosmetology training and a credential upon completion. You can enroll in a certificate (or diploma) course, or you can pursue an Associate’s degree. Certificate programs usually call for 12 to 18 months to complete, while an Associate’s degree commonly takes about 2 years. If you enroll in a certificate program you will be trained in all of the main areas of cosmetology. Shorter programs are available if you prefer to specialize in just one area, for example hair coloring. A degree program will also likely feature management and marketing training in order that graduates are better prepared to manage a parlor or other Grand Island NY business. Higher degrees are not common, but Bachelor and Master’s degree programs are offered in such specializations as salon or spa management. Whatever type of program you go with, it’s important to make certain that it’s approved by the New York Board of Cosmetology. A number of states only recognize schools that are accredited by certain highly regarded organizations, for instance the American Association of Cosmetology Schools (AACS). We will cover the benefits of accreditation for the school you choose in the next segment.

Online Cosmetology Courses

student attending online beauty school in Grand Island NYOnline beauty programs are accommodating for Grand Island NY students who are working full time and have family responsibilities that make it difficult to attend a more traditional school. There are numerous online cosmetology school programs offered that can be accessed through a home computer or laptop at the student’s convenience. More traditional cosmetology programs are often fast paced given that many courses are as brief as six or eight months. This means that a considerable portion of time is spent in the classroom. With online courses, you are dealing with the same volume of material, but you are not spending many hours away from your home or commuting to and from classes. On the other hand, it’s essential that the training program you pick can provide internship training in local salons and parlors in order that you also get the hands-on training required for a comprehensive education. Without the internship portion of the training, it’s impossible to obtain the skills needed to work in any area of the cosmetology field. So be sure if you choose to enroll in an online school to confirm that internship training is available in your area.

Is the School Accredited? It’s essential to make certain that the cosmetology training program you enroll in is accredited. The accreditation should be by a U.S. Department of Education certified local or national agency, such as the National Accrediting Commission for Cosmetology Arts & Sciences (NACCAS). Programs accredited by the NACCAS must meet their high standards ensuring a quality curriculum and education. Accreditation can also be essential for acquiring student loans or financial aid, which typically are not offered in 14072 for non- accredited schools. It’s also a prerequisite for licensing in some states that the training be accredited. And as a final benefit, a number of Grand Island NY businesses will not hire recent graduates of non-accredited schools, or may look more favorably upon individuals with accredited training.

Grand Island, New York

Grand Island is a town located in Erie County, New York, United States. As of the 2010 census, the town's population was 20,374,[3] representing an increase of 9.41% from the 2000 census figure.[4] The town's name derives from the French name La Grande Île, as Grand Island is the largest island in the Niagara River and fourth largest in New York state. The phrase La Grande Île appears on the town seal.

Over its history, Grand Island has served as home to the Attawandaron Nation and been an acquisition of both French and English colonial pursuits. In 1945, Grand Island was part of a plan to make a new World Peace Capital on the international border between Southern Ontario, Canada, and Western New York. The plan proposed placing the United Nations headquarters on adjacent Navy Island (Ontario), which was considered an ideal location because it lay on the boundary between two peaceful countries. An artist's rendering of the World Peace Capital showed the property with bridges spanning both countries (between Grand Island in the United States and the Canadian mainland).[5] The proposal was turned down in favor of the current U.N. headquarters in New York City.

The town of Grand Island is located in the northwestern corner of Erie County, and on the Canada–US border, although there is no river crossing to Canada. It is northwest of Buffalo and is traversed by Interstate 190 and New York State Route 324.
